RING IN THE NEW YEAR WITH NEW WLA EDITOR 

After 33 years, Donald Anderson is retiring as Editor of WLA. Longtime Poetry Editor Thomas McGuire is assuming the reins effective 1 January 2022:  Thomas.McGuire@afacademy.af.edu
